创建各类三角形图案

简介: C 语言实例 - 创建各类三角形图案

创建三角形图案。

实例 - 使用 * 号

include

int main()
{
int i, j, rows;

printf("行数: ");
scanf("%d",&rows);

for(i=1; i<=rows; ++i)
{
    for(j=1; j<=i; ++j)
    {
        printf("* ");
    }
    printf("\n");
}
return 0;

}

*

  • *



实例 - 使用数字

include

int main()
{
int i, j, rows;

printf("行数: ");
scanf("%d",&rows);

for(i=1; i<=rows; ++i)
{
    for(j=1; j<=i; ++j)
    {
        printf("%d ",j);
    }
    printf("\n");
}
return 0;

}

1
1 2
1 2 3
1 2 3 4
1 2 3 4 5
实例 - 使用字母

include

int main()
{
int i, j;
char input, alphabet = 'A';

printf("输入大写字母: ");
scanf("%c",&input);

for(i=1; i <= (input-'A'+1); ++i)
{
    for(j=1;j<=i;++j)
    {
        printf("%c", alphabet);
    }
    ++alphabet;

    printf("\n");
}
return 0;

}

相关文章
|
定位技术 图形学
|
1月前
FW怎么做立体箭头? fireworks三维立体箭头的制作方法
我们在FW绘制图形时,有时候经常需要用到立体的效果。该怎么回执箭头并添加立体效果呢?下面我们就来看看详细的教程。
28 1
FW怎么做立体箭头? fireworks三维立体箭头的制作方法
|
1月前
创建三角形图案
【10月更文挑战第24天】创建三角形图案。
17 3
|
6月前
技术经验解读:三维空间中直角坐标与球坐标的相互转换
技术经验解读:三维空间中直角坐标与球坐标的相互转换
197 0
|
7月前
OEEL——使用OEEL快速画出精美图案(以土地利用转移变化为例)
OEEL——使用OEEL快速画出精美图案(以土地利用转移变化为例)
46 0
|
7月前
|
定位技术
ArcGIS面要素最小外接矩形、外接圆的绘制方法
ArcGIS面要素最小外接矩形、外接圆的绘制方法
113 1
|
7月前
实训一:构建圆和矩形对象
实训一:构建圆和矩形对象
|
存储 编解码 定位技术
案例!从天地图中提取全市的建筑物矢量轮廓-以苏州市为例
案例!从天地图中提取全市的建筑物矢量轮廓-以苏州市为例
263 1
关于已知线段,如何求封闭图形轮廓的一些猜想
关于已知线段,如何求封闭图形轮廓的一些猜想
|
C# 图形学
C#绘制自定义小人
C#绘制自定义小人